Porkins Policy Radio 168 2018 End of Year Special with Abby Martin, Robbie Martin and JG Michael

In the first hour Abby and Robbie Martin for an end of the year special. We kick things off by talking about our overall impressions of 2018. Abby and Robbie touched on the stories and narratives that were most important during this tumultuous year. We then moved into the realm of geopolitics and some of the biggest events which took place in 2018. We talked about the war in Yemen and the continued violence against the Palestinians. We discussed the lack of media coverage on foreign affairs this year, and how Trump has ceded power to the neocon movement when it comes to geopolitics. We touched on figures like John Bolton and what may be in store for America in the coming year. Later Abby talked about the sanctions against Venezuela which led to The Empire Files being shut down. We round out the hour by talking about some of the positive things in 2018 including David Seaman having to close down his news outlet.

In the second hour JG Michael of Parallax View joins me to continue our end of the year special. We focused more on the culture war of 2018. We looked at the right-wing movement and the casualties it sustained this year. JG talks about Gavin McInnes and his recent appearance on InfoWars. We talked about the idea that many of these alt-lite figures are actually fading away. We discussed Ross Douthat’s repulsive article Why we miss the WASPs and the rehabilitation of war criminals like George HW Bush and Dick Cheney. JP and I explored what this means for America going forward. We round out the conversation by again looking at some positives like the momentum of figures like Ocasio-Cortez and others. I also brought up the strange revelation that white supremacist Jean Francois Griepy took $25,000 from Jeffrey Epstein in 2014.

Porkins Policay Radio episode 152 Who is Jeffrey Epstein with Sam Spadino

This week my guest is comedian and activist Sam Spadino. Sam recently made headlines for getting thrown out of a Trump rally in Duluth for holding up a picture of Trump and Jeffrey Epstein with the caption, “Who is Jeffrey Epstein?” Sam and I talk about the day in question and what it was like. We discuss the sentiment at the rally and the strange announcements made about how to deal with protesters. Sam explains how he got the signs in and the experience of making eye contact with the president while holding up the picture. Sam talks about the media attention the protest received. We talk about how Fox news covered this story and the less than polite way they spoke about Sam and his hair. Sam also address the negative comments he has received from Trump supporters. Later Sam and I talk about the importance of exposing Epstein and his friends in high places. We also present the reasons for why we think real progress can be made regarding this issue. I finish off by touching on Alex Jones’ recent absurd claim that Mueller is protecting Epstein, and his desire to duel him politically.

Meet James Kirchick: Neocon propagandist

20140307-131500.jpg

By now I am sure we have all heard about the resignation of Liz Wahl, and the public condemnation of Putin by Abby Martin. Both worked/work for Russia Today, and both have created a media storm here in the west. Apparently Liz Wahl just discovered that she was working for a Russian government-funded news outlet and was shocked, shocked I tell you, to discover that they had a bias towards Russia. Liz Wahl, of course, got her start interning for the always fair and balanced Fox News. In the background of these stories has been an American propagandist neocon by the name of James Kirchick. Kirchick has been seen in recent days on the three letter corporate controlled news outlets spewing all sorts of lies and slander. He took to MSNBC to call Abby Martin an “out and out lunatic” for questioning the official conspiracy theory of 9/11, and for thinking that industrial fluoride put into our water supply is detrimental to our health. My god, what a nut she is!

His other little pet project has been helping out his fellow neocon Liz Wahl, and going to RT America’s headquarters and calling everyone there a Kremlin puppet. So I though a little background on Kirchick was in order.

Kirchick is first and foremost  an American propagandist. He formerly worked for Radio Free Europe. For anyone unclear, RFE is a US government-funded “media outlet” that takes it’s direction from the State Dept. and CIA. Since then Kirchick has gone on to work for Bill Kristol’s neocon think tank “Foreign Policy Initiative.” Kirchick also has the honor of being a former fellow at another neoconservative think tank called the Foundation for Defense of Democracy. FDD loves democracy so much that it appointed former Director of CIA James Woosley as chairman. And if that’s not enough, Kirchick writes for the corporate-owned Daily Beast.

James Kirchick rose to the spotlight on Wednesday August 21, 2013 when he appeared on RT to discuss the sentencing of Pvt. Manning. You’re asking why was Kirchick invited on in the first place? Well he had just penned a cute little article in the NY Daily News saying that Manning deserved the death penalty for his actions. During the interview, instead of defending this psychopathic idea, Kirchick started attacking Russia and RT in regards to the anti-gay propaganda law. Much to his chagrin he wasn’t cut off immediately, and was allowed to talk for around two minutes. Later off air he was caught saying he only went on RT to “fuck with the Russians.”
